NOTHING can re-pLACE—>QUIANA MICHELLE DEES
Nothing can replace
Your smiling face or warm embrace
That’s apart of my heart
My LIGHT in the DARK same as
Matches and sparks burns and leaves a MARK
It never Fades since you left
The city of ASBURY PARK
Tears telling tales to truths
Hearing hope nope and cope
With your departure tragic a lost
It echoes and Never let Goes
A pain to feel that’s so real
Reminding me at every vacant meal
I found had to LOOK up not Down
Cause imagining you resting on a cloud
That I emotionally scream at loud
A part of you always in me
Telling fate you made a mistake
Leaving tears could never be a waste because
NOTHING can re-pLACE—>QUIANA MICHELLE DEES {R*i*P)
